libsrtp 1.6.0 is out with these fixes: + PR #293 Fix incorrect result of rdb_increment on overflow + + PR #290 - Cipher type cleanup for AES + When libSRTP is compiled with OpenSSL and the AES 256 ICM cipher is used + with RTCP an incorrect initialization vector is formed. + This change will break backwards compatibility with older versions (1.5, + 2.0) of libSRTP when using the AES 256 ICM cipher with OpenSSL for RTCP. + + PR #281 - Sequence number incorrectly masked for AES GCM IV + The initialization vector for AES GCM encryption was incorrectly formed on + little endian machines. + This change will break backwards compatibility with older versions (1.5, + 2.0) of libSRTP when using the AES GCM cipher for RTCP.
